First of all, 2017 proved to be a strong financial year, contributing to the continued rebuilding of our nest egg so that we can make future investments back into CSIA. We had a member retention rate of 87% this past year and a growth in Certified Integrators of 5.8%, which was great to see. The investment in the development of the Industrial Automation Exchange is now paying off as well, as we exceeded its budgeted revenue by $2,500 while keeping our direct costs very close to budget. Tony continues to do a great job of promoting participation on the Exchange, as well as helping our members utilize their profiles to their advantage. The amount of content on Exchange continues to boost our Google Search rating, and we are quickly becoming the place to go for all things related to Systems Integration.

One last thing I wanted to make the membership aware of is that I have nominated Luigi De Bernardini, our current Treasurer, to the role of Vice Chairman. The board of directors has also approved this nomination, so this year, Luigi will continue to serve as treasurer and will also be mentored to take over the helm as CSIA Chairman of the Board at the 2019 Executive Conference.
